Matalik was born on January 30, 1933 to Andrew and Anna (Mato) Matalik. He was a lifelong resident of the Whiting-Robertsdale Community and a graduate of George Rogers Clark High School, Class of 1951. &nbsp;He was a member of St. John The Baptist Catholic Church, Whiting, and the First Catholic Slovak Ladies Assoc., BR. 81. &nbsp;Edward was a US Navy Veteran of the Korean Conflict and was a retiree of the Lever Bros. Company (Unilever), Hammond with decades of service . Ed loved to read and travel, especially taking family vacations and cherished the time spent with his grandchildren. &nbsp;Devoted to his family, Edward will be sadly missed by all who knew and loved him.
